Types of UBA Codes for Transfers

Not all UBA codes are created equal. Depending on the type of transaction you're conducting, you might encounter different codes. Let’s break them down:

Domestic Transfer Codes

These codes are used for transferring funds within Nigeria or between UBA branches. They’re typically shorter and more straightforward, making domestic transactions a breeze.

International Transfer Codes

When it comes to sending money abroad, things get a little more complex. UBA uses SWIFT codes and IBANs to facilitate international transfers, ensuring your funds reach their destination safely and swiftly.

Using UBA Codes for International Transfers

International transfers can be a bit trickier, but with the right UBA codes, they’re entirely manageable. When sending money abroad, ensure you have the recipient’s full details, including their SWIFT code and IBAN. This information is crucial for a successful transfer.

Key Considerations

Keep in mind that international transfers may incur fees, and exchange rates can vary. Always check with UBA for the latest rates and fees to avoid any surprises.
